Trouble with Rotorua electoral rules bill

From Morning Report, 8:15 am on 26 April 2022

Attorney-General, David Parker, says the Rotorua District Council Representation Arrangements Bill is discriminatory, despite it receiving the Labour Party's backing.

Deputy Prime Minister Grant Robertson told Morning Report this morning he could not support the bill in its current form.

The Rotorua District Council Representation Arrangements Bill would allow the Maori and general wards to have the same number of seats, with three each, plus four "at-large" seats.
